récupérer une chaine numérique

Répondre


Cette question est un moyen d’empêcher des soumissions automatisées de formulaires par des robots.
Smileys
:D :) :( :o :shock: :? 8-) :lol: :x :P :oops: :cry: :evil: :twisted: :roll: :wink: :!: :?: :idea: :arrow: :| :mrgreen: =D> #-o =P~ :^o :non: :priere: 8-|
Voir plus de smileys
  Revue du sujet
 

  Étendre la vue Revue du sujet : récupérer une chaine numérique

merci

par James » 18 févr. 2005, 15:09

merci je vais essayer :)

par goeb » 18 févr. 2005, 13:02

avec ereg_replace, tu peux faire un truc du genre :

Code : Tout sélectionner

$chaine="la chaine 123.55 de test"; $nombre = ereg_replace(".*([0-9]+)\..*", "\\1", $chaine);
je ne l'ai pas essayé. mais ça doit être bon, ou pas loin de ce que tu veux.

récupérer une chaine numérique

par James » 18 févr. 2005, 11:31

Salut,

voila j'ai une chaine de caractère dans laquelle je veux récupérer une chaine numérique. Voici un exemple :

$machaine="Voici un exemple de chaine dans laquelle se trouve les chiffres 12.58, je ne veux pouvoir récupérer que les deux premiers chiffres";

Dans mon exemple, je veux une fonction qui me récupère le chiffre 12.

Je précise que mon caractère numérique n'apparait qu'une seule fois dans ma chaines de caractère, et qu'il est toujours de la forme 00.00

merci à vous